Update 1.13.5

Global physics changes, new graphics settings, game engine update, and other improvements.

Car Physics

We've taken your feedback from the open beta into account and adjusted the car settings.

  • Racing and Racing+ tire physics settings updated — the new parameters make car behavior more predictable during corner entry, braking, and sudden weight transfer between axles. In addition, the new settings significantly reduce the tendency of cars to understeer.

  • Aerodynamics settings for most cars reworked — more cars will now be competitive in Time Attack mode, reducing the gap between different models in the car fleet.

  • Body swap weight adjusted — the updated settings will further reduce the gap between cars in the game roster.

  • Car center of mass parameters updated — the new settings reduce the tendency of cars to roll over and excessive body roll in corners, allowing more effective high-speed cornering and better acceleration out of corners after reaching the apex.

  • Car body inertia parameters reworked — the new settings reduce nervous behavior in high-speed corners, improve the sense of car weight, and make suspension behavior more predictable in fast corner sequences.

  • Brake force settings refined — braking performance has become more stable and predictable.

Tuning

Drivetrain swap from all-wheel drive to front-wheel drive has been added for the following cars:

  1. TTR

  2. EV6

  3. EV9

  4. EVX

  5. SFR

  6. WST

  7. WRS

  8. YRS

Driving Assist

Driving assist algorithms reworked — the update allows more aggressive corner attacks without excessive intervention from the assist system.

Game Physics

Reworked collision system between the player's car, environmental objects, and other players' cars added. New system results in:

  1. reduced car pushback during tandem drift contact;

  2. reduced impact of collisions with roadside objects;

  3. reduced risk of cars getting stuck on curbs and roadsides in the city's mountain areas.

Game Engine

  • Game engine version updated.

  • DirectX 12 support added.

  • Overall graphics quality improved — visual systems of the game refined.

Graphics quality settings added. You can now separately adjust the following parameters:

  1. draw distance;

  2. texture quality;

  3. reflection quality.

General Improvements

  • Opponent selection in Time Attack races added.

  • Game loading time reduced.

  • Gear shifting speed slightly increased while using Prototype-class clutch.

Fixes

  • Issue with transmission noise from other players' cars being played in first-person view fixed.

  • Gear shift sound volume adjusted.

  • Various issues on the "Wangan" location fixed.

  • Livery display for AMD graphics cards fixed. DirectX 12 is required for the fix to work correctly.
